Overview:

Medical Assistant Pediatric Neurology is a medical professional who provides support to pediatric neurologists in the diagnosis and treatment of neurological disorders in children. They are responsible for performing a variety of tasks, such as taking patient histories, preparing patients for examinations, administering medications, and providing patient education.

Detailed Job Description:

Medical Assistant Pediatric Neurology is responsible for providing support to pediatric neurologists in the diagnosis and treatment of neurological disorders in children. This includes taking patient histories, preparing patients for examinations, administering medications, and providing patient education. They must be able to accurately record patient information, maintain patient records, and communicate effectively with patients and their families. They must also be able to work with a variety of medical equipment and be knowledgeable about the latest medical technologies.
